    Army Reserve Pfc. Matthew Tumen, a combat engineer with the 979th Engineer Company, Mobility Augmentation Company, and Bexley, Ohio, resident, digs a hasty fighting position for his team to pull security from during the Combat Support Training Exercise 14-02 April 26 to May 16 at Fort McCoy, Wis. The team was providing security while other unit members used D7 bulldozers to dig an anti-tank ditch as a counter-mobility measure. (U.S. Army photo by Staff Sgt. Debralee Best)
